What Is a Target Audience?
A target audience is a group of individuals who are most likely to be interested in your product or service based on demographics, interests, problems, and behavior. Identifying your target audience helps ensure that your ads are more precise, relevant, and capable of generating higher conversions.
To identify your target audience, you need to understand who your ideal customer is, their problems, interests, and online behavior. Use data such as demographics, interests, and pain points so your ads become more accurate, costs are lower, and conversions increase.

Steps to Identify Your Target Audience
1. Identify Your Ideal Customer (Customer Avatar)
Ask these questions:
- What is their age?
- Male or female?
- Working professional or student?
- Income level?
π This is known as basic demographics.
2. Understand Their Problems (Pain Points)
People buy because of problems, not products.
Examples:
- Want to lose weight β health products
- Want extra income β business courses
π The more specific the problem, the easier it is to sell.
3. Identify Their Desires
Besides problems, understand what they want:
- To look attractive
- To live comfortably
- To be successful
π Desire = motivation to buy.
4. Understand Their Behavior
Examples:
- Which platform do they use?
- When are they online?
- What type of content do they like?
π This helps optimize your ads.
5. Identify Their Interests
Use data such as:
- Hobbies
- Brands they follow
- Daily activities
π This is crucial for ad targeting (Facebook/TikTok).
Advanced Techniques to Identify Your Audience
1. Competitor Analysis
Analyze:
- Who engages with their content
- The type of audience they attract
π A shortcut to understanding your market.
2. Use Existing Data
If you already have:
- Customer lists
- Followers
π Analyze:
- Who is most active
- Who purchases the most
3. Surveys & Feedback
Ask your audience:
- What problems they face
- Why they bought your product
π Real data is more accurate than assumptions.
4. Test & Optimize (A/B Testing)
Do not rely only on theory.
π Test:
- Audience A vs Audience B
- Different interests
π Choose the best-performing audience.

Simple Framework: 4P Audience Targeting
- Profile β Demographics
- Problem β Pain points
- Passion β Interests
- Platform β Where they are active
π An easy framework to get started.
